According to an interview with Standard Sports, Tottenham striker Harry Kane hinted at staying at the club as he has no intention to go anywhere else and also wants Antonio Conte to stay. He stated that Conte is a very good coach and he wants to play under him in the next season as they work very well under his coaching.

The Italian- based Spurs’ coach Conte didn’t provide any update but he consistently aims at leaving the club next summer after the champions league qualification is tentative for the next season. Kane wants Conte to continue but feels it is his decision for sure to talk to the club and decide on his future as he is one of the finest coaches he has ever played with and wants to play in future.

The Englishman has no intention to leave the club amid rumours of his transfer took the limelight but he has no plans of leaving the Spurs any time around. Manchester City had been targeting Kane since last summer but he refused and continued to stay after he is left with very few options, Kane will be seen in Tottenham for a few more years. Tottenham has been improving since Conte’s signing as the Spurs’ coach and they have been doing well.

Kane told Standard Sport, “I have said I am a big fan of his and we get on really well so, of course, it would be great for the club if he stays. But like I have said that is his decision, he’s his own man, and I’m sure he will talk to the club and decide on his future.”

“I think the improvement has definitely been there since the gaffer came into where we are now. It shows it can be done in a short space of time, but obviously, we will see what happens over the summer and look forward to the next season with a great manager. Hopefully, we’ve learnt a lot since he’s been here”, he added.

Harry Kane’s Tottenham might grab the Champions League spot next season after Arsenal drops all three points against Newcastle United

Tottenham is currently at the fourth spot with 68 points from 37 games with one game in hand while Arsenal is now two points behind them in an equal number of matches.

If Harry Kane’s Tottenham wins their next fixture against Norwich City, they will seal the Champions League spot from the Gunners. Even if Arsenal wins their last match against Everton at home and Tottenham pulls off a draw, Conte’s side will still finish fourth as they are 15 points ahead of Arsenal in the goal differential.
